
Former Wisconsin Badger Davies Recalled by Wolves
Published on November 3, 2010 under American Hockey League (AHL)
Chicago Wolves News Release
The Chicago Wolves have recalled forward MICHAEL DAVIES from the ECHL's Gwinnett Gladiators.
DAVIES shares second on the Gladiators with five assists and holds third with six points in six games this season. Last year, the 23-year-old forward set a career-high and shared sixth in the NCAA with 52 points (20G, 32A) in 41 games as a senior with the University of Wisconsin (WCHA).
The Chesterfield, Mo., native ranked second on the Badgers with a career-best 20 goals and third with a career-most 32 assists, and made his professional debut in three Calder Cup playoff games with the American Hockey League's Bridgeport Sound Tigers after Wisconsin was defeated in the 2010 NCAA National Championship game.
Overall, DAVIES amassed 54 goals, 69 assists, 123 points and 122 penalty minutes in 155 games with the Badgers, spanning four seasons (2006-10).
